first of all, once fs gets mounted with extents support any newly created
files/dirs will be stored in extents-format. thus, if you remount that fs
w/o extents support you won't be able to access those files/dirs

I really propose you don't use extents on a partitions you care about for a while.

quite interesting result. could you help me to investigate that?
it would be great to go through following steps:
1) create fresh ext3 fs
2) mount it w/o extents option
3) run dbench 16 for few times (say, 4)
make sure it performs on that filesystem (cd <mntpoint>; dbench -c ... 16)
4) unmount fs
5) recreate that fs
6) mount it with extents option
'EXT3-fs: file extents enabled' should be printed in logs
7) run dbench 16 for few times
8) unmount that fs and take a look in logs, you should see stats info about
extents usage
